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
400174 113 49 9385344418
30007543 1777 21470142992
30007543 1777 21470142992
13944 93 2732906
All about undefined
Interested in learning more?
30007543 1777 21470142992
13944 93 2732906
See more
63355 27637454 7963959
55360776 9800716434 96128783935 8185
See more
343104144 66289833313
421384 575 439546200 11 146
See more